[发明专利]一种虚级联组延时超限的处理方法和装置无效
申请号: | 200810133185.8 | 申请日: | 2008-07-09 |
公开(公告)号: | CN101626278A | 公开(公告)日: | 2010-01-13 |
发明(设计)人: | 罗伟 | 申请(专利权)人: | 中兴通讯股份有限公司 |
主分类号: | H04J3/08 | 分类号: | H04J3/08;H04J3/16 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 518057广东省深圳市南山*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 级联 延时 超限 处理 方法 装置 | ||
技术领域
本发明涉及虚级联组(VCG,Virtual Concatenation Group)处理技术,尤其是指一种VCG延时超限的处理方法和装置。
背景技术
同步数字体系(SDH,SynCHronous Digital HieraCHy)网络作为一种成熟的传输网,目前已经得到了大规模的建设和应用。为了让数据业务也能在SDH网络上传送,应用了SDH中的虚容器(VC,Virtual Concatenation)、连接能力调节计划(LCAS,Link Capacity Adjustment SCHeme)等技术,使得SDH网络满足了数据业务带宽高,具有带宽调整灵活等特点。
虚级联技术是一种将多个成员组合为一个整体来传递高带宽业务的技术,而LCAS技术则提供了一种动态调整这个整体的成员个数的方法。利用虚级联技术传递数据业务的时候,将SDH中的VC通道,或称成员在逻辑上捆绑在一起,共同传递一个完整的数据流,这些VC通道捆绑在一起构成了VCG,VCG内每个成员传递的数据都是完整的数据流中不可或缺的一部分。VCG中的成员在传输的过程中,由于传输路径的不同,当所有成员从源端到达宿端后,各个成员存在着延时差,宿端需要用缓存将各个成员的数据对齐,而缓存的大小决定了处理各个成员之间延时差的能力。当SDH网络中VC成员的延时发生变化,例如SDH网络中出现倒换异常,导致某些成员的路径发生改变的时候,网络延时增加,如果成员之间的延时差超出了缓存所能容纳的范围,就会导致宿端不能恢复出完整的数据流。
目前的VC实现方案中,当出现以上情况的时候,整个VCG的数据流将不能恢复。
发明内容
有鉴于此,本发明的主要目的在于提供一种VCG延时超限的处理方法和装置,利用本发明,能够在VCG中出现延时超限成员时,保证宿端能够恢复出完整的数据流。
为达到上述目的,本发明的技术方案是这样实现的:
一种虚级联组延时超限的处理方法,该方法包括以下步骤:
A、预设定锁存周期,根据到达宿端的虚级联组内各成员的开销字节,得到同步数字体系SDH中虚容器的复帧帧头;
B、锁存周期到时,根据SDH中虚容器的复帧帧头得到到达宿端的虚级联组内各成员的复帧指示及复帧偏移量;
C、对所得到的虚级联组内各成员的复帧指示及复帧偏移量进行比较,并得到虚级联组内各成员的延时比较结果,虚级联组内各成员以各自的序列号标示符为标志根据虚级联组内各成员的延时比较结果反馈成员状态域给源端;
D、源端根据虚级联组内各成员所返回的成员状态域无效临时删除延时超限成员,将延时超限成员所承载的数据分配给非延时超限成员,非延时超限成员将所承载的数据发送给宿端,宿端根据接收到的数据恢复出完整的数据流。
其中,步骤C中所述对得到的虚级联组内各成员的复帧指示及复帧偏移量进行比较进一步包括:通过比较到达宿端的虚级联组内各成员的复帧指示及复帧偏移量找到虚级联组内所有成员中到达宿端最早的成员;根据虚级联组具有的延时补偿缓存得到缓存可以容纳的延时差范围;得到虚级联组中所有的成员与达宿端最早的成员的复帧差,将所有复帧差与缓存可以容纳的延时差范围比较;
得到的虚级联组内各成员的延时比较结果为:最早到达成员和在缓存可以容纳的延时差范围内的复帧差对应的非最早到达成员为非延时超限成员;不在缓存可以容纳的延时差范围内的复帧差对应的非最早到达成员为延时超限成员。
进一步地,步骤C中所述根据虚级联组内各成员的延时比较结果反馈成员状态域给源端为:非延时超限成员反馈成员状态域有效给源端;延时超限成员反馈成员状态域无效给源端。
较佳地,该方法进一步包括:重复步骤B和步骤C,源端根据虚级联组内各成员所返回的成员状态域,确定延时超限的成员的状态恢复为成员状态域有效后,将延时超限成员增加到虚级联组成员中,虚级联组组内所有的非延时超限成员一起将数据发送给宿端,宿端根据接收到的数据恢复出完整的数据流。
进一步地,源端将延时超限成员临时删除的方法为:源端下发不使用被宿端报告为无效状态的成员的控制命令给延时超限成员,延时超限成员停止承载有效数据;
相应地,源端将延时超限成员增加到虚级联组成员中的方法为:源端下发正常传输或虚级联组中最后一个成员的控制命令给延时超限成员,延时超限成员恢复承载有效数据。
进一步地,寻找虚级联组内所有成员中到达宿端最早的成员时,先比较各个成员的复帧指示,如果复帧指示相等,比较各个成员的复帧偏移量。
较佳地,锁存周期大于虚级联组内各成员的复帧指示及复帧偏移量比较所占用的时间。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中兴通讯股份有限公司,未经中兴通讯股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200810133185.8/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种无刷直流电机
- 下一篇:一种光网络中错连阻错的实现方法